In today’s highly digitized marketplace, building and maintaining a strong web presence is no longer optional—it’s essential. Whether you’re launching a startup, expanding an eCommerce store, or updating your corporate website, hiring a skilled web developer is a critical decision. But that leads to a key question: should you hire a freelance web developer or bring on a full-time developer?
Each option has its unique benefits and drawbacks. Your decision should depend on your business size, project scope, budget, and long-term goals. This article breaks down the pros and cons of both choices to help you determine which type of developer is best suited for your web development needs.
Freelance Web Developers: Flexibility and Specialization
Freelancers are independent professionals who typically work on a per-project basis. In the web development world, freelancers can range from generalists to highly specialized experts in front-end, back-end, or full-stack development.
Pros of Hiring Freelancers:
- Cost-Effective
Freelancers often come at a lower cost than full-time employees. You pay for the work done—no benefits, office space, or long-term commitments required. This makes freelancers an excellent option for startups or short-term projects. - Specialized Skills
Need a developer who specializes in WordPress customization, eCommerce platforms, or Laravel development? Freelancers often focus on niche areas, making it easier to find someone with the exact expertise you need. - Global Talent Pool
When you hire freelancers, you’re not limited by geography. You can collaborate with experienced developers anywhere in the world—including top-tier talent from an Indian Website Company, known for quality and affordability. - Scalability
Freelancers are ideal for scaling up temporarily during busy periods or handling overflow work.
Cons of Hiring Freelancers:
- Availability Issues: Freelancers juggle multiple clients, so their availability might not align with your timeline.
- Lack of Continuity: Once the project ends, they move on. This can be a drawback if your website requires ongoing updates and maintenance.
- Limited Accountability: Without formal contracts or long-term engagement, quality assurance and communication can sometimes be inconsistent.
Full-Time Web Developers: Consistency and Long-Term Value
Full-time developers are dedicated employees who become integrated into your company’s workflow and culture. They’re ideal for businesses that require continuous development, site maintenance, or rapid scaling of digital assets.
Pros of Hiring Full-Time Developers:
- Reliability and Commitment
A full-time developer is aligned with your business objectives and available during working hours. This consistency leads to better communication, faster turnarounds, and higher accountability. - Deep Understanding of Your Brand
Over time, full-time developers gain in-depth knowledge of your business, users, and technology stack, which enables them to deliver better long-term solutions. - Team Collaboration
Full-time staff can collaborate seamlessly with other departments—marketing, content, sales, etc.—creating a more cohesive development process. - Security and Confidentiality
When sensitive data or proprietary technology is involved, having a vetted, in-house developer reduces the risk of data breaches or intellectual property issues.
Cons of Hiring Full-Time Developers:
- Higher Cost: Salaries, benefits, office space, and other expenses make full-time hires more expensive than freelancers.
- Longer Hiring Process: Recruiting and onboarding a full-time employee can take weeks or even months.
- Limited Flexibility: Full-time developers may not always have the breadth of skills that freelancers with varied project experience possess.
Key Factors to Consider Before Deciding
- Project Duration and Complexity
If you need a website built from scratch with ongoing support and upgrades, a full-time developer might be a better choice. However, for a one-time project or seasonal work, a freelancer is likely more cost-effective. - Budget
Startups and small businesses often find freelancers more budget-friendly. For larger organizations with stable cash flow, investing in a full-time developer can pay off in the long run. - Speed and Flexibility
Freelancers tend to work faster and offer greater flexibility in terms of hours and contract length. But if you need someone available on-demand for daily tasks, a full-time developer provides more dependable availability. - Control and Supervision
Do you prefer someone embedded in your company culture who’s easy to manage and monitor? Then full-time is the way to go. If you’re comfortable managing remotely and focusing on deliverables rather than daily presence, a freelancer can be ideal. - Hybrid Approach
Many companies today use a hybrid model: hiring a full-time developer for core tasks and using freelancers for specialized, short-term projects. This allows businesses to balance flexibility and reliability.
Conclusion
There is no universal answer to whether a freelance or full-time web developer is better—it depends on your specific needs, goals, and resources. Freelancers offer flexibility, specialized skills, and cost-efficiency, making them perfect for short-term or niche projects. Full-time developers offer long-term value, stability, and deeper integration into your business.
If you’re seeking affordability with access to a global talent pool, partnering with an established Indian Website Company is a smart move. They provide a blend of freelance agility and enterprise-level reliability. Likewise, if you’re looking to Hire PHP Developers in India, you’ll find a wide range of skilled professionals capable of handling projects of any scale.
Ultimately, the best choice is the one that aligns with your long-term strategy, technical needs, and workflow preferences. Evaluate carefully, plan ahead, and you’ll build a team that delivers high-impact digital results.
